Finnish Football: Rising Stars and Domestic Triumphs
Finnish football has been making significant strides on the international stage, with both the men's and women's national teams garnering attention. The Huuhkajat, Finland's men's national team, have been building on their historic qualification for UEFA Euro 2020, showcasing a blend of youthful exuberance and seasoned experience. Meanwhile, the Helmarit, the women's national team, continue to push boundaries in the UEFA Women's competitions.
Domestically, the Veikkausliiga has seen an exhilarating season, with HJK Helsinki leading the pack. Their tactical depth and consistency have set them apart, but the chasing pack, including KuPS and FC Inter, remain hot on their heels, ensuring a thrilling title race. The emergence of young talents like Marcus Forss and Linda Sällström highlights Finland's growing proficiency in nurturing footballing talent.
Player Development: The Finnish Pipeline
Finland's football academies are becoming increasingly recognized for their role in developing players with technical prowess and mental fortitude. Clubs are heavily investing in youth development programs, focusing on holistic education that combines sports with academics. Such initiatives are crucial for the future of Finnish football, as they aim to produce players capable of competing in Europe's top leagues.
Finnish exports like Glen Kamara and Rasmus Schüller have showcased their skills on an international platform, providing inspiration for the next generation. As these players excel abroad, they bring invaluable experience back to the national setup, enriching the tactical and cultural perspectives of Finnish football.
